Senior Software Engineer

20 hours ago


Richardson, Texas, United States Yahoo Holdings Inc. Full time

At Yahoo, we're looking for a talented Senior Software Engineer to join our team. As a key member of our engineering team, you'll be responsible for designing, building, and launching efficient and reliable data pipelines to move and transform data at scale.

Our ideal candidate will have a strong background in Java and/or Python development, as well as experience with ETL design using Big Data stack environments. You'll also have a deep understanding of real-time processing tools, such as Kafka, PubSub, Storm, and Spark streaming.

As a Senior Software Engineer, you'll work closely with data analysts, product owners, and other engineers to understand business problems and technical requirements. You'll deliver high-quality data solutions through rigorous checks and have excellent data modeling skills to understand the nuances of various dimension and metric types in the warehouse.

Responsibilities:

  • Design, build, and launch efficient and reliable data pipelines to move and transform data at scale.
  • Build real-time data ingestion pipelines that are capable of processing 100s of thousands of events per second.
  • Interact with data analysts, product owners, and other engineers to understand business problems and technical requirements.
  • Deliver high-quality data solutions through rigorous checks.
  • Have excellent data modeling skills to understand the nuances of various dimension and metric types in the warehouse.
  • Design workflows to ingest, load, present, and publish new data sets for various use cases.
  • Lead data investigations to troubleshoot data issues and drive resolution.

Requirements:

  • BS/MS in Computer Science or a related major, or equivalent experience.
  • 5 years of Java and/or Python development experience.
  • 3 years of experience in ETL design using Big Data stack environments (Hadoop, MapReduce, Pig, Hive, Oozie, Apache Beam, Airflow, etc.).
  • Experience with Google Cloud Platform (BigQuery, Dataproc, Composer, Dataflow, GCS, etc.).
  • Experience or familiarity with real-time processing tools (Kafka, PubSub, Storm, Spark streaming).
  • Experience with schema design and dimensional data modeling.
  • Comfortable writing complex SQL queries.

At Yahoo, we're committed to creating a collaborative, inclusive environment that encourages authenticity and fosters a sense of belonging. We strive for everyone to feel valued, connected, and empowered to reach their potential and contribute their best.

Equal Opportunity Employer - minorities/females/veterans/individuals with disabilities/sexual orientation/gender identity.



  • Richardson, Texas, United States Raytheon Careers Full time

    Job Title: Senior Software EngineerAt Raytheon Careers, we are seeking a highly skilled Senior Software Engineer to join our team in Richardson, Texas. As a key member of our team, you will have the opportunity to work on classified programs and technologies that align with your passions.Job Summary:We are looking for a talented Senior Software Engineer with...


  • Richardson, Texas, United States Judge Group, Inc. Full time

    Job Title: Senior Software EngineerJob Summary:The Judge Group, Inc. is seeking a highly skilled Senior Software Engineer to join our team. As a Senior Software Engineer, you will be responsible for designing, developing, and deploying scalable software systems and software infrastructure. You will work closely with software engineers, network/system...


  • Richardson, Texas, United States Raytheon Careers Full time

    Job Title: Senior Software EngineerWe are seeking a highly skilled Senior Software Engineer to join our team at Raytheon Careers. As a key member of our software development team, you will play a critical role in designing, developing, and deploying software solutions that meet the needs of our customers.Key Responsibilities:Design and develop software...


  • Richardson, Texas, United States Raytheon Careers Full time

    Job Title: Senior Software EngineerAt Raytheon Careers, we are seeking a highly skilled Senior Software Engineer to join our team in Richardson, Texas. As a key member of our software development team, you will play a critical role in designing, building, and maintaining efficient, reusable, and reliable code.Key Responsibilities:Design and develop software...


  • Richardson, Texas, United States Motion Recruitment Full time

    Senior Software Engineer OpportunityWe are seeking a highly skilled Senior Software Engineer to join our team at Motion Recruitment. This is a 4-month contract position with the potential to convert into a full-time role.Key Responsibilities:Develop, maintain, and enhance client systems of moderate to high complexity.Design and implement strategic partner...


  • Richardson, Texas, United States Collins Aerospace Full time

    Job Title: Senior Embedded Software EngineerWe are seeking a highly skilled Senior Embedded Software Engineer to join our Integrated Strategic Solutions Engineering (ISSE) team at Collins Aerospace. As a key member of our team, you will be responsible for designing, developing, and testing software for our integrated mission systems.Key...


  • Richardson, Texas, United States Raytheon Full time

    Job Title: Senior Java Software EngineerRaytheon is seeking a highly skilled Senior Java Software Engineer to join our team in Richardson, Texas.Job Summary:We are looking for a talented software engineer with a strong background in Java and experience working in a Linux environment. The ideal candidate will have a solid understanding of software principles,...


  • Richardson, Texas, United States The Computer Merchant, LTD (TCM) Full time

    Job Title: Senior Software Systems EngineerWe are seeking a highly skilled Senior Software Systems Engineer to join our team at The Computer Merchant, LTD (TCM). As a key member of our systems engineering team, you will be responsible for designing and developing software systems that meet the needs of our clients.Key Responsibilities:Collaborate with...


  • Richardson, Texas, United States Raytheon Careers Full time

    Senior Systems Engineer - Hybrid SoftwareAt Raytheon Careers, we're seeking a highly skilled Senior Systems Engineer to join our team. As a key member of our software development team, you will be responsible for the continued development of an advanced, leading-edge, hybrid software system.This role requires a strong understanding of software design,...


  • Richardson, Texas, United States Raytheon Full time

    Job Title: Senior Java Software EngineerAt Raytheon, we are seeking a highly skilled Senior Java Software Engineer to join our team in Richardson, Texas.This role requires a strong foundation in Java and experience working in a Linux environment to comprehend customer needs and translate those needs into viable design solutions.The ideal candidate will have...


  • Richardson, Texas, United States Collins Aerospace Careers Full time

    Job Title: Senior Embedded Software EngineerWe are seeking a highly skilled Senior Embedded Software Engineer to join our team at Collins Aerospace Careers. As a key member of our Integrated Strategic Solutions Engineering (ISSE) team, you will play a critical role in designing and developing software solutions for our customers.Key Responsibilities:Provide...


  • Richardson, Texas, United States Paladin Consulting Full time

    Job Title: Senior Software EngineerJob Description & Responsibilities:In this role, you will utilize your expertise in Java and experience working in a Linux environment to comprehend customer needs and translate those needs into viable design solutions.Opportunity to apply your understanding of software principles, theories, and concepts related to software...


  • Richardson, Texas, United States Raytheon Careers Full time

    Job Title: Senior Java Software EngineerRaytheon Careers is seeking a highly skilled Senior Java Software Engineer to join our team in Richardson, Texas. As a Senior Java Software Engineer, you will play a critical role in designing, building, and maintaining efficient, reusable, and reliable code.Key Responsibilities:Design and develop software solutions...


  • Richardson, Texas, United States GEICO Full time

    Job SummaryGEICO is seeking a highly skilled Senior Software Engineer to join our team. As a key member of our engineering staff, you will be responsible for designing and implementing high-performance, low-maintenance, zero-downtime platforms and applications.Key ResponsibilitiesDesign and implement enterprise data governance solutionsDesign and implement...


  • Richardson, Texas, United States Raytheon Full time

    Job Title: Senior Java Software EngineerWe are seeking a highly skilled Senior Java Software Engineer to join our team in Richardson, Texas. As a key member of our software development team, you will play a critical role in designing and developing software solutions that meet the needs of our customers.Key Responsibilities:Design and develop software...


  • Richardson, Texas, United States Raytheon Full time

    About the RoleRaytheon is seeking a skilled Senior Software Engineer to join our team in Richardson, Texas. As a key member of our software development team, you will be responsible for designing, building, and maintaining efficient, reusable, and reliable code. You will work closely with our cross-functional teams to comprehend customer needs and translate...


  • Richardson, Texas, United States RTX Full time

    About the Role:We are seeking a highly skilled Senior Software Engineer to join our team at RTX. As a key member of our software development team, you will be responsible for designing, building, and maintaining efficient, reusable, and reliable code.Key Responsibilities:Design and develop software solutions using Java and Linux environmentsCollaborate with...


  • Richardson, Texas, United States Collins Aerospace Full time

    Job Title: Senior Embedded Software EngineerWe are seeking a highly skilled Senior Embedded Software Engineer to join our team at Collins Aerospace. As a key member of our Integrated Strategic Solutions Engineering (ISSE) team, you will play a critical role in designing and developing software solutions for our customers.Key Responsibilities:Provide direct...


  • Richardson, Texas, United States Educated Solutions Corp Full time

    Job SummaryWe are seeking a highly skilled Senior Software Engineer to join our team at Educated Solutions Corp. This is a 4-month contract role that offers a competitive hourly rate of $63. The ideal candidate will have prior experience in Java and Angular Development, as well as a strong understanding of web mapping tools and spatial databases.Key...


  • Richardson, Texas, United States Volt Full time

    Job OverviewVolt is seeking a highly skilled Senior Java Software Engineer to join our team in Richardson, TX. As a key member of our engineering team, you will be responsible for designing, building, and maintaining efficient, reusable, and reliable code.Key Responsibilities:Design and develop software solutions using Java and Agile methodologiesCollaborate...